Which intakes will clear the 87-93 valve covers on a 95 mustang without using the 1/2 inch spacer. I have a cobra intake now but I have to use the spacer with it because the egr hits and the vacuum pipe on the drivers side hits. I want to keep my stock hood so that is my problem with running any other intake with a spacer.
 
I have a Cobra intake with the Fox chrome covers. BE CAREFUL! Before I had my spacer I had to grind down that metal fitting that screws into the bottom on the drivers side. I did not take that into consideration before tightening down the upper when I heard a "crack". :mad:
Punched a large hole right through my new chrome valve covers. :nonono:
You should be fine with the spacer, just check the clearance of that mofo piece.
 
I've got the Eddy Performer 5.0 with fox valve covers and clears. Seen the RPM with fox covers. I think even the trick flow intakes will clear... Basically any aftermarket intake will clear them because they are designed for the fox body cars (the reason we need to buy the elbow adapter)
